WebMay 1, 2024 · Long known as the European Elm Flea weevil (Orchestes alni), this non-native was thought to be wreaking havoc on elms in the U.S. since the early 2000s. However, recent research revealed this species does not occur in the U.S. The true culprit is another non-native weevil, O. steppensis. WebMay 20, 2024 · The holy handiwork of the Elm Flea Weevil (Orchestes steppensis) is evident on native, non-native, and hybrid elms in southwest Ohio. Holes in elm leaves result from the adult “snout beetles” feeding on the leaves as well as the larvae tunneling between the upper and lower leaf surfaces as leafminers.
